What you'll learn

  • Diagnose a complex business situation using critical thinking, benchmarking and data analytics skills

  • Like a management consultant, discover and prioritize problems by combining competitive intelligence with problem diagnosis and storytelling skills

  • Identify levers and isolate issues with the greatest financial stakes using strength and weakness analysis, value driver and breakdown analysis

  • Assess industry trend, risk, and competition intensity, and detect abnormalities and alarms through industry analysis and competition positioning

There are 4 modules in this course

Welcome to Business Intelligence and Competitive Analysis (or competitive intelligence for short)! In Week 1, you will learn the story of American Airlines Group, the challenges it faces, and the framework of competitive intelligence. You will also get a feel for competitive intelligence through a comparison of the world's major economies.

In Week 2, you will learn industry analysis, including industry potential, risk and competition intensity, and value chain analysis.

In Week 3, you will learn how to position a company within an industry to find out where the company stands in the competitive landscape.

In Week 4 (final week), you will learn enterprise diagnosis to discover a company's strengths and weaknesses, identify performance drivers and levers, and through a breakdown analysis of revenue, cost or assets, to discover the key problems and the root causes.
